This is an exciting opportunity for an established supervisor, team leader or grounds maintenance professional to take a leading role in delivering high-quality grounds maintenance services across the borough.
As Senior Team Leader, you will provide operational leadership to frontline teams responsible for maintaining the Council's parks, sports pitches, cemeteries, open spaces, landscaped areas and other green assets. You will ensure work is completed safely, efficiently and to a high standard while supporting continuous improvement and excellent customer service.
Working closely with managers and operational staff, you will help plan and oversee maintenance programmes, undertake quality inspections, monitor performance and support the development of the workforce. The role offers the opportunity to make a real difference to the appearance and quality of Broxtowe's parks and green spaces.

About Disability Confident
Disability Confident is a government scheme. It encourages employers to recruit and retain disabled people and those with long term health conditions.
